Charles Basler*

Instructor of Legal Writing

Education

JD New England Law | Boston
BA Boston University

Professional Background

Upon graduating from New England Law | Boston, Charles Basler joined the Law Office of Adam Bond in Middleboro, Massachusetts. The Firm is a small, general practice law firm which provides representation in a wide variety of legal areas, such as: general civil litigation, personal injury & wrongful death, veteran’s benefits, landlord-tenant, real estate disputes, and small business matters. Together with the Firm’s principal, Attorney Basler has developed one of the state’s top practices in manufactured housing law and serves as general and trial counsel for manufactured housing communities across the state. Attorney Basler has appeared before nearly every court in Massachusetts as well as the U.S. District Court for the District of Massachusetts, and has experience in litigation, mediation, arbitration, and appeals. He is also an accredited attorney with the U.S. Dept. of Veteran’s affairs, before which he represents our disabled military veterans. Attorney Basler is a member of the FINRA (Financial Industry Regulatory Authority) arbitration roster and is eligible to arbitrate disputes involving financial brokers and brokerage firms in the Massachusetts area.
